Regards comparés: Corées, déjouer les destinins - Journeys of Korean women

Evènement

Published on 29/10/2024

Since 2012, Inalco has been a partner of the Jean Rouch Festival, screening films from the Regards comparés selection in the auditorium. This year, screenings will be held from November 25 to 28 on the theme of Korea. All screenings will be followed by a debate with filmmakers and experts.

Inalco's Continuing Education Department awarded FCU quality certification

Actualité

Menu Formations

Published on 21/02/2022

On January 1, 2022, Inalco's Service Commun de la Formation Continue (SCFC) was awarded FCU quality certification by an independent third party, Bureau Veritas Certification, for a period of three years. This national recognition of the quality of its services strengthens the Institute's position in the professional training market.
